Which of the following was a reason village and town life in New England was much less involved with slavery than was the South?

History
1 answer:
NemiM [27]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

A frigid climate and rocky soil prevented the region from developing a cash crop.

Explanation:

The main reason why hundreds of thousands of enslaved Africans were brought to the American colonies was the existence of large plantations where cash crops such as tobacco, rice, indigo, sugar, and cotton were grown.

These cash crops required warm climates, good soils, and more or less humid conditions which were not present in New England.

The Puritans, who made up the majority of the population in New England, also had stronger moral objectios against slavery (this is why abolitionism was so strong in New England), but from a materalist point of view, the answer is what was explained above.

Was Gavrilo Princip a angry citizen Austrian sniper Australian soldier or American assassin
Allushta [10]

Answer:

Gavrilo Princip was an angry citizen.

Explanation:

Gavrilo Princip was a Bosnian Serb conspirator who killed the heir to the Austro Hungarian Empire on 28 June 1914. He was linked to the Serbian secret organization Black Hand, which had previously become known for terrorist operations.

He was one of many conspirators who wanted as much independence as possible for their homeland, Bosnia, occupied by Austria-Hungary, hoping that this would be possible within the Kingdom of Serbia. The fact that it was Principle who killed Franz Ferdinand was largely coincidental, as several possible assassins involved in the conspiracy had been placed on the Archduke's cortege route in Sarajevo. Immediately after the assassination of the Archduke, Princip was arrested and sentenced to 20 years in prison.
